A leading building control service provider is seeking a Building Inspector to develop into a registered inspector. Candidates should have construction trade experience and a Level 3 NVQ.

This role offers a salary up to £40,000, hybrid working, and a generous benefits package including training and development opportunities.

The ideal candidate will have strong customer service skills and the ability to manage time effectively.
